
We are now living in the T-Pain era of choruses and hooks composed of autotune catchiness. And while many attribute this idea to Roger Troutman, best known for the hit "Computer Love", I thought this would be a good segment to show some history of the talkbox being used even before Roger Troutman. The incredible musical genius Stevie Wonder, who many have said inspired Troutman to begin using it in his music can be seen in this short segment doing a rendition of The Carpenters song "Close To You".
